We had our first date on St. Patrick's Day 2000. It was supposed to be a small party but nobody else showed up. They got married exactly one year later on St. Patrick's Day 2001. Jocelynn was born July 2004. Gryphon was born March 2007. He had severe medical problems and spent his first month of life in the hospital. The medical problems caused Cerebral Palsy as well as other long term problems. We were really able to see the power of prayer and the love of God during this time. Later that year we felt God calling us to China as missionaries. We have friends that are missionaries to China so we decided to visit China in March 2008. After we returned home we found ourselves missing it and prayed about going into full time missions. We knew that we wanted to join a YWAM base that had a focus on China. That is what lead us to YWAM Pismo Beach. We moved our family to Pismo in January of 2010 to do our DTS. Mike's brother Matt came along to help watch Gryphon. We went to China for our outreach in April. We are now on staff full time and have a heart to lead outreach teams into China on a yearly basis.
